Cometic headgaskets on LTx engine issues

Has anyone here used the Cometic MLS style headgaskets on a LTx engine and experienced oil seepage at or near the number 7 or 8 cylinders. I have a problem with oil seeping out near the inside head bolt just below the 7 and 8 exhaust ports. Oil is not coming from above at the valve covers nor is it coming from the intake china wall area.

Hi Bret, the block was prepped for use of the MLS gasket. When I discovered the leak that was my first question to the machine shop, as I told them what gasket I was intending to use. I didn't use the copperseal spray. I was told by cometic NOT to use any sealer on the gasket. Now I wish I had........is that a requirement from your experience??
